Creedence Clearwater Revival - Members

Members

Years Line-up Releases
1968–1971
  • John Fogerty – lead vocals, lead guitar, harmonica, keyboards, saxophone
  • Tom Fogerty – rhythm guitar, backing vocals, piano
  • Stu Cook – bass guitar, backing vocals, keyboards
  • Doug Clifford – drums, percussion, backing vocals
  • Creedence Clearwater Revival (1968)
  • Bayou Country (1969)
  • Green River (1969)
  • Willy and the Poor Boys (1969)
  • Cosmo's Factory (1970)
  • Pendulum (1970)
1971–1972
  • John Fogerty – lead vocals, lead guitar, keyboards, harmonica
  • Stu Cook – bass guitar, lead and backing vocals, keyboards, guitar
  • Doug Clifford – drums, percussion, lead and backing vocals
  • Mardi Gras (1972)
